1 The Common Council of the City of Richmond, Indiana, serving as a Board in
2 charge of the operation of the Richmond Power & Light Plant, met in regular
3 session October 19, 1981 at the hour of 7:00 p.m. in the Municipal Building
4 of said City. Chairman Welch presided with the following members present:
5 Messrs. Elstro, Williams, Ahaus, Hankinson, Mills, Parker, Carter and Paust.
6 Absent: None. The following -business was had, to-wit: .

20 REPORT OF STREET LIGHT COMMITTEE
21
22 Chairman of the Street Light Committee Larry Parker stated his committee has
23 reviewed the petition for two (2) street lights on Mikan Drive and have approved
24 the drawings from the Commercial Division of RP&L. This will be sent to the •
25 Board of Works with the Committee's recommendation.

27 OPEN BIDS FOR' TWO NEW LINE TRUCKS (CAB & CHASSIS) AND ONE NEW AERIAL DEVICE
28
29 General Manager Irving Huffman presented a proof of publication for the above
30 to City Attorney Ed Anderson and he found it to be in order. Councilman Ahaus
III31 moved it be accepted and filed, seconded by Councilman Williams and on unani-
32 mous voice vote the motion was carried.
